BIO

As an International Trade Manager, Joe is a veteran trade developer in Virginia. He served as Director of Educational Programs and Services for the Virginia Department of World Trade and the Virginia Economic Development Partnership from 1988 until 1992. From 1992 until 1998, Joe was an International Trade Development Specialist at Virginia Tech.


While at Virginia Tech, Joe co-authored and administered funded proposals totaling over $2.5 million. Among these was a proposal for $1 million to fund export development of Information Technology and Telecommunications from Northern Virginia. Through another U.S. Department of Commerce program, Joe represented Virginia businesses in Poland, the Czech Republic, Austria, the Slovak Republic, Mexico, Chile and Bolivia. A third grant funded the World Trade Institute through which economic developers are taught export fundamentals.


Joe Adams led the development of numerous business plans for business incubators, manufacturing facilities and market expansions in Virginia. He administered over 150 custom International Market Plans for Virginia businesses. In the private sector, he co-founded a highly successful coffee-exporting firm in LaPaz, Bolivia, which just celebrated its 26th anniversary.


Joe is a past Chairman of the Training and Education Committee for the Virginia Economic Developers Association. He served as Program Chair for the Virginia Chamber's Conference on World Trade from 1995 until 1997. Dr. Adams was named by the Secretary of Commerce and Trade to serve on the Governor's "Opportunity Virginia" Strategic Planning Committee. Joe received the 1996 Governor's Award for Excellence in International Market Planning.


Joe served as an adjunct faculty member at George Mason University (GMU) in the Masters in Commerce and Policy Program from 1991 until 1998. At GMU, he developed and taught two courses on international economic development.


Joe has a B.A. in Business Administration, an M.A. in Spanish Literature, and a Ph.D. in Educational Administration.
